Volume Extruder

The volume extruder fills in the extruded region with extruded volume cells from the input surface. You control the amount of divisions in the extruded region the volume extruder operation. You must have a volume mesh set up in parts to use the extruder in parts.

Volume Extruder Properties

Parameter Description
Input Parts Specifies the part that acts as the source for the extruder. The input part must be a Surface Extruder part.
Auto-Retraction When activated, runs a check for intersections and retract the volume if necessary.

Volume Extruder Controls

Parameter Description
Number of Layers Specifies the number of cells in the direction of extrusion. The default value is 1, which is the minimum. There is no maximum limit to the number of layers allowed.
Stretching Method Specifies the spacing between the layers. Constant extrudes in a specified direction with constant thickness layers. One Sided Geometric uses geometric progression to compute cell thickness. One Sided Hyperbolic uses a hyperbolic stretching law to compute the cell distribution growth in the direction of the extrusion. This option is geared specifically for aerospace and other applications where the boundary layer resolution is considered critical. Two Sided Hyperbolic uses hyperbolic stretching from both ends to compute cell distribution.

Volume Extruder Stretching Options

Parameter Description
Stretching > Stretch Value Specifies the ratio of spacing at layer n and layer n+1.
Initial Wall Thickness > Initial Wall Thickness Specifies the thickness of the first layer of cells near the input part surface.
Thickness Ratio > Thickness Ratio Specifies the layer spacing between the first layer and the last layer of cells.
